
Worked on the headlamp-k8s/headlamp repository to enhance Kubernetes resource graph visualization and frontend usability. Focused on stabilizing Resource Map graph traversal by preserving cyclic edges and accurately identifying connected components, which improved data integrity for operators. Delivered frontend improvements using React and TypeScript, including enforcing minimum dropdown widths for better UI consistency. Implemented CRD-aware graph visualization with ownership edges and integrated CRD details into KubeObjectDetails, enabling more accurate representation of custom resources. Refactored frontend components by standardizing hook naming and localizing state, which simplified maintenance and onboarding. Utilized CSS, JavaScript, and TypeScript to deliver maintainable, user-focused solutions.
May 2025: Focused on making the frontend graph visualization more accurate and maintainable. Delivered CRD-aware Graph Visualization with ownership edges and enhanced CRD details integration, along with refactors to the Frontend Resource Map and GraphSourceView that standardized hook naming and localized active item state. These changes improve the usefulness of the Kubernetes graph view, speed up issue diagnosis, and simplify frontend maintenance and onboarding.
May 2025: Focused on making the frontend graph visualization more accurate and maintainable. Delivered CRD-aware Graph Visualization with ownership edges and enhanced CRD details integration, along with refactors to the Frontend Resource Map and GraphSourceView that standardized hook naming and localized active item state. These changes improve the usefulness of the Kubernetes graph view, speed up issue diagnosis, and simplify frontend maintenance and onboarding.
February 2025 monthly summary for the headlamp-k8s/headlamp repo focused on stabilizing the Resource Map graph traversal and improving UI usability. Delivered a critical bug fix to preserve cyclic edges and correctly identify connected components, along with a frontend usability enhancement to the Resource Map dropdown to ensure minimum width and content-fit. The work enhances data integrity, reliability, and user experience for operators managing Kubernetes resource graphs.
February 2025 monthly summary for the headlamp-k8s/headlamp repo focused on stabilizing the Resource Map graph traversal and improving UI usability. Delivered a critical bug fix to preserve cyclic edges and correctly identify connected components, along with a frontend usability enhancement to the Resource Map dropdown to ensure minimum width and content-fit. The work enhances data integrity, reliability, and user experience for operators managing Kubernetes resource graphs.

Overview of all repositories you've contributed to across your timeline